#include <pwd.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include "userinfo.h"
static char *default_domain=NULL;
static struct uid_range *included_uids=NULL;
struct uid_range *add_uid_range(uid_t min, uid_t max)
{
// walk through the list
struct uid_range **hereptr = &included_uids;
struct uid_range *here = *hereptr;
while (here) {
// check if the new range will touch the current range
// there are 3 possibilities
// 1) the new range does not touch and comes before
// 2) the new range does not touch and goes behind
// 3) the new range does overlap or touch
if (max < here->min) { // non-touching, before
// insert the new range before the current one
struct uid_range *new = (struct uid_range *)malloc(sizeof(struct uid_range));
new->min = min;
new->max = max;
new->link = here;
*hereptr = new;
return new;
}
if (min < here->min && max >= here->min) { // overlapping at front
// update the current range to start earlier
here->min = min;
// check if there's more overlap behind
if (max > here->max) {
min = here->max+1;
// let the next iterations check where to fit this
}
else { // otherwise, we're done
return here;
}
}
hereptr = &(here->link);
here = *hereptr;
}
// reached the end of the list without finding a place to insert
// append a new range
*hereptr = (struct uid_range *)malloc(sizeof(struct uid_range));
(*hereptr)->min = min;
(*hereptr)->max = max;
(*hereptr)->link = NULL;
return (*hereptr);
}
// check if uid is included in our list of ranges
int included_uid(uid_t id)
{
struct uid_range *here = included_uids;
while (here) {
if (here->min <= id && id <= here->max)
return 1;
here = here->link;
}
return 0;
}
void set_default_domain(const char *domain)
{
if (default_domain) free(default_domain);
default_domain = strdup(domain);
}
char *add_default_domain(char *username)
{
static char *buffer=NULL;
char *p = strchr(username, '\\');
if (p == NULL) {
if (default_domain) {
if (buffer) free(buffer);
buffer=(char *)malloc(strlen(default_domain)+strlen(username)+2);
strcpy(buffer, default_domain);
strcat(buffer, "\\");
strcat(buffer, username);
return buffer;
}
else
return username;
}
else
return username;
}
